Power and cost planning

RX 5500/5500M/Pro 5500M kWh POWER CONSUMPTION & COST

Power consumption information for the RX 5500/5500M/Pro 5500M is based on an average wattage taken from vendor information for the lowest and highest power draws for the GPU under Folding@Home compute loads.

Wattage information is only for the GPU and does not include the host computer's power usage.

Reading the averages

Why your PPD may differ

PPD is a guide, not a fixed result. Daily output changes with the work-unit mix, including project, points, atom count, and deadline, as well as system conditions such as OS, drivers, clocks, thermals, and power limits.
